if you have been properly maintaining your sand bed, which is easy, just put in your nass snails, you really wont have any gasses.

The gasses really only show in up in deep sand beds that have been undisturbed for a long period of time and those gases are deadly.

The nass snails keep the top inch or so mixed which prevents the accumulation of gunk in there.
